Zaya New or Old

Anybody know how the flavor compares? If I missed it on an earlier post I apologize.

Haven't had it myself, but the folks over at ministryofrum.com say it has a stronger vanilla flavor, and maybe a touch sweeter. They compare it to Angostura 1919 (Angostura is the new distiller that produces Zaya), and some admit that they may not notice the difference if they weren't looking for it.

Be careful in your interpretation (and public posting). It is my understanding that it is illegal for any individual to ship liquor across any state line. In some cases (depending on local law / jurisdiction) it may be illegal to ship cross counties with-in a state.

If you referred to various merchant details on-line - that isn't an indication of anything other than the licensing fees they have paid in order to be authorized to ship to those said states. It requires legal authorization (applications + fees paid + authorization granted) per state.

Now if you're working for or connected to a store, that's one thing, but I believe the purchase off the shelf from one retail location and resale / shipping through use of another merchant's authorized destinations would come into question legally too.
